Abstract
The interaction between two two-level atoms and N-level atoms (su(2) quantum system) in the non-resonance is investigated. The explicit mathematical form for the wave function is obtained. Statistical aspects, the population inversion, linear entropy, correlation function and the negativity are discussed. The influence of the number of levels and the detuning parameter on the population and atom-atom entanglement are studied. The results are shown that the entanglement depends crucially on the detuning.
